    Larry Bird is the only player in NBA history to shoot better than 50-40-90 four straight years while averaging over 28 PPG. Only two other players in NBA history have ever shot better than 50-40-90 in a season even once and none four straight seasons. Had Larry's chronic injured back injury not occurred, there is no telling how many more years he would have kept that streak going. Three straight league MVP's. And that's not counting the double digit career rebounding average and being the best passing forward in history. Celts go from 29 wins before his rookie year to 61 wins his rookie year and there was no Parish, McKale, DJ, or Ainge on that team, just the same guys who won only 29 plus Larry Bird. Greatest one year win improvement by ANY team in NBA history and it came because of the addition of a rookie. It proved that Bird carrying a bunch of no-name players at Indiana State to a undefeated season, slaying one giant after another during March madness until that 1979 NCAA championship game was no fluke. What he did at sad sack Indiana State has never been repeated and what he did his rookie year at (then) sad sack Boston has never been repeated. There is a reason for that, a very precise reason...BECAUSE NO ONE SINCE HAS BEEN AS GOOD AS BIRD AND THEREFORE COULDN'T DO THOSE THINGS AND DIDN'T DO THOSE THINGS. You will never see another Larry Joe Bird. In fact, think about what an in pain, old, chronic back injured with a compressed nerve root in his back, 12 weeks away from his last NBA game, Larry Bird did on March 15, 1992. On March 15, 1992 the Western Conference leading Portland Trailblazers had a game in Boston on a Sunday in prime time. Bird didn't have many decent days that last couple years especially, but on this day, either he fought the pain especially hard or his back game him some small respite. That March 15, 1992 49 points scored that day by an old broken down Larry Bird was the most points with a triple double in the 1990's in the entire NBA. It wasn't until 2015 until anyone had a triple double with that many points or more. That's 23 years. In fact, you had to go back to 1975 where Kareem Abdul Jabbar had 50 and a triple double to find a previous triple double game that exceeded it. The 1980's? Nobody reached at least 49 points with a triple double in the 1980's. Two guys came close in the 1980's: In the 1980's a fellow named Michael Jordan had 48 and a triple double, and another fellow named Larry Bird had 47 and a triple double.😊 Bird also had a game against Portland in the mid 1980's where he scored 49, and he scored his first 26 points of that game LEFT HANDED, and he was a right handed shooter. Why did he do that? Because he could. There will never be another Larry Joe Bird.
